PROBLEM TO BE SOLVED: To provide the material for crusher parts having improved abrasion resistance, impact resistance and thermal shock resistance. SOLUTION: The material used as the crusher parts is a sintered body of silicon nitride, which contains 75-95 wt.% of silicon nitride, at least one element selected from Y and rare-earth elements in an amount of 1-12 wt.% expressed in terms of its oxide, Al in an amount of 0.01-5 wt.% expressed in terms of its oxide, and oxygen as impurity in an amount of <=10 wt.% expressed in terms of SiO2 , and has a density of >=3.20 g/cm<3> , a porosity of <=3% and a average void diameter of <=5 μm, and further has such spectrum property that the ratio of the height of the peak at 206 cm<-1> of silicon nitride, measured by Raman spectroscopy, to that of the peak at 521 cm<-1> of Si is in the range of 0.2-3, and furthermore if necessary, may contain an amount of <=8 wt.% of at least one metal compound selected from among the group of the metal compounds containing Mg, W, Mo, Mn, Cu and Fe. |
